in circle b, bc = 3 and m∠cbd = 80°. find the length of cd. express your answer as a fraction times π (in simplest form).

Explanation:

Step1: Recall the arc - length formula

The formula for the length of an arc \(s\) of a circle is \(s=\frac{\theta}{360}\times2\pi r\), where \(\theta\) is the central angle in degrees and \(r\) is the radius of the circle.

Step2: Identify the values of \(\theta\) and \(r\)

Given that \(\theta = m\angle CBD=80^{\circ}\) and \(r = BC = 3\).

Step3: Substitute the values into the formula

Substitute \(\theta = 80\) and \(r = 3\) into \(s=\frac{\theta}{360}\times2\pi r\).
